Abstract

The author presents a calculation of fields in laminated structures and a computation of integral parameters by a method suggested in the present work and used for mixtures with spherical particles. Based on Lorenz' determination of mean quantities, a new model of a disperse system (DS) is suggested. Using the theorem of a vector field, the fields and mean values of inhomogeneous systems are calculated from the condition of equality between the energies of the electric fields of the real medium and its model. The method is more general and permits one to obtain new formulas for calculating mean parameters of DS.
